2026/02/12 Googleアナリティクスを確認すると突如アクセスが膨大に跳ね上がった
サーバーログを見てみると、OpenAIのGPTBotがまぁDDos攻撃か?ってくらいアクセス連打してきていた模様
ログ確認
apacheのログからアクセス元のIPアドレスで出てきた回数を抽出
4桁以上は見た限り全部Botであり、回数ブチ抜いてるGPTBotは約15万/日のアクセスもしてきていた
Xで検索するとサーバーが不調になった原因だったという人も居たので
立派なDDoS攻撃と言っても差し支えないだろう
ubuntu@tk2-117-59341:/var/log/apache2$ sudo awk '{print $1}' /var/log/apache2/access.log.6 | sort | uniq -c | sort -nr | head -n 10
87195 74.7.241.42
54500 74.7.227.157
8333 144.76.32.236
2113 127.0.0.1
588 xxx.xxx.xxx.xxx
546 xxx.xxx.xxx.xxx
541 xxx.xxx.xxx.xxx
466 xxx.xxx.xxx.xxx
402 xxx.xxx.xxx.xxx
399 xxx.xxx.xxx.xxx
ubuntu@tk2-117-59341:/var/log/apache2$ sudo awk '{print $1}' /var/log/apache2/access.log.5 | sort | uniq -c | sort -nr | head -n 10
75330 74.7.241.15
16498 74.7.241.42
12143 144.76.32.236
11269 74.7.243.239
3023 127.0.0.1
2663 74.7.227.38
2571 74.7.227.133
2520 74.7.241.21
2499 74.7.242.26
1516 74.7.243.195
ubuntu@tk2-117-59341:/var/log/apache2$ sudo awk '{print $1}' /var/log/apache2/access.log.4 | sort | uniq -c | sort -nr | head -n 10
151783 74.7.241.15
7904 144.76.32.236
2786 127.0.0.1
992 xxx.xxx.xxx.xxx
700 xxx.xxx.xxx.xxx
668 xxx.xxx.xxx.xxx
574 xxx.xxx.xxx.xxx
573 xxx.xxx.xxx.xxx
555 xxx.xxx.xxx.xxx
513 xxx.xxx.xxx.xxx
ブロック設定
とりあえずrobots.txtに禁止する設定を入れておく
直近のログから確認できた行儀悪いBot達を拒否
新規作成する場合は ファイル名の間違い に注意しよう
私は最初 sが抜けたrobot.txtを作成するという
何の意味も無かった恥ずかしいミスをやらかしていました
User-agent: GPTBot
Disallow: /
User-agent: CCBot
Disallow: /
User-agent: ClaudeBot
Disallow: /
User-agent: SERankingBacklinksBot
Disallow: /
他にもBotは色々あるので、全量ブロックするならここら辺の記事も参考にできそう
【解説】ChatGPTのクローラーBotを拒否する方法
【2025年版】ChatGPTなどの生成AIのクローラーBotを拒否する方法
これまでクローラーとか特に気にしてなくお好きにどうぞというスタンスだったが
支障が出るレベルのやらかしされると流石に対処せざるを得ない
02/17追記
robots.txtを設定してもなおBotが止まらずアナリティクスが汚れまくっているので
アクセス元のIPアドレスを横着せずに調べ直した
すると、ClaudeBotの他にClaude-SearchBotが居たのと
MJ12botという何年も前から有名らしい害悪BOTがいたことが判明
とりあえず追記して様子見
